Output 5bba89d71a7e91c0f0f1cd22e3fd04d6bc4345180f8be36ce732f25e04f2321a:1

value
8505721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644eba1f026ec587fb467bb3df8b70db59fb1c2f OP_EQUAL
address
MH3Y7fSV4xhwm5RgxvWhAC9r6WboktD7nB
transaction
5bba89d71a7e91c0f0f1cd22e3fd04d6bc4345180f8be36ce732f25e04f2321a
spent
true